Disproving the Myth of Cleaning Harder for Cleanser Teeth



Do not think the misconception that cleaning harder will certainly cause cleaner teeth. Lots of people believe that applying more stress while brushing will get rid of a lot more plaque and bacteria from their teeth. However, this isn't true, and as a matter of fact, it can be damaging to your dental health.

Brushing also hard can harm your tooth enamel and aggravate your periodontals, leading to level of sensitivity and gum economic crisis. The secret to reliable brushing isn't compel, but method and uniformity.

It's suggested to use a soft-bristled toothbrush and mild, circular activities to clean all surface areas of your teeth. Furthermore, brushing for at the very least 2 mins twice a day, along with regular flossing and dental check-ups, is crucial for preserving a healthy smile.

Common Dental Myths: What You Required to Know



Do not be tricked by the myth that sugar is the major wrongdoer behind dental caries and cavities.

While it holds true that sugar can contribute to dental troubles, it isn't the single cause.



Dental cavity takes place when harmful germs in your mouth eat the sugars and starches from the foods you consume.

These microorganisms generate acids that deteriorate the enamel, leading to dental caries.

Nevertheless, inadequate oral hygiene, such as inadequate brushing and flossing, plays a significant function in the growth of dental caries too.

Furthermore, certain variables like genetics, dry mouth, and acidic foods can also contribute to dental problems.
